A pair of mahogany ships washstands, early 20th century
each with a pierced superstructure and an open shelf above a panelled fall front revealing a metal lined interior with a bowl and soap dish, stamped HMS Keppel, with a cupboard below enclosing green painted metal cistern and water jug, each -- 22½in. (57cm.) wide
